Output 44f6ebe0e0f74002eab9833d88634cc37ba2eb904fbc27b2dffcdb5ed74a8500:1

value
862814968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a479edfb210da4e909373b80e3109a0e48 OP_EQUAL
address
3BMEXHCAaLoSwNacDR2B86TEZsVbEUxm21
transaction
44f6ebe0e0f74002eab9833d88634cc37ba2eb904fbc27b2dffcdb5ed74a8500
spent
true